If you are concerned about the total cost of your wedding, know that you are not alone. So many people find themselves in the same situation that you are in right now. Fortunately there are ways that you can save money on your upcoming wedding without compromising your big day.
Don’t Set the Date for a Saturday
Sure, you might think that Saturday is the best day to get married and this may be the case in terms of your guests and their availability. But at the end of the day, you might need to make sure that you save money as well. If you get married a few days after, then you may find that your venue is able to give you a huge discount and that you are also able to get the same turnout in terms of your guests too.

Venue Vendors
If you go with a venue then they may try and convince you to use their vendors. Although there is nothing wrong with this, you should consider other venues if budget is a factor. If your venue has a policy where you are not allowed to use other vendors then this may cause you problems. You are locked into using their vendors and vendor prices which might not match your budget.

Ceremony and Reception in the Same Place
If you need to save on your wedding, try to have your ceremony and the reception at the same place. Choosing a wedding location where you can have both occasions will likely save you money on rental fees. Additionally, you don’t have to worry about transporting and that you don’t need to compromise on the luxuries of your big day either. Your out of town guests won’t have to worry about getting lost either. Having your wedding at one location will help ugest to relax and put their mind at ease.
Silk Flowers
Instead of buying real flowers that cost a small fortune, think about using silk flowers instead. When you invest in silk flowers, you will soon see that they are very luxurious and that they look just as good. Some wedding vendors will rent them out to you, and this can save you a considerable amount of money. By using silk flowers, you will also be able to get flowers that are out of season. This is a fantastic way for you to have your dream bouquet on a budget.
